New Orleans is 17% more affordable than Tacoma. A $75,000 salary in Tacoma is equivalent to $62,179 in New Orleans.

Housing is typically the biggest factor in any cost-of-living comparison. New Orleans has a housing index of 95 while Tacoma sits at 140 (national average = 100). The median home in New Orleans costs $245,000 compared to $400,000 in Tacoma, a difference of $155,000. Monthly rent follows a similar pattern: $1,200 in New Orleans versus $1,600 in Tacoma.
Groceries and everyday expenses show a notable difference: New Orleans scores 99 while Tacoma scores 105. Both cities are close to the national average for grocery costs.
Healthcare costs in New Orleans (94) are lower than Tacoma (106). Both are close to the national average.
Median household income in New Orleans is $43,258 compared to $58,974 in Tacoma. When adjusted for cost of living, income goes further in New Orleans.
